WebThe tenant GUID is an identifier that is used by Azure AD. It is used in Gizmo WebUI SSO to ‘lock’ a WebUI to a Microsoft tenant. The main (and unique) domain name associated to a tenant is based on .onmicrosoft.com domain (e.g. gsxclients.onmicrosoft.com). WebYou can get all of the objects in Active Directory using the Filter * parameter. Get-ADObject cmdlet connects to the AD domain controller or Lightweight Directory Service Server and returns active directory objects.Get-ADObject uses the Identity parameter to get specific Active Directory objects.
